POSITION TITLE Area Sales Manager – Northwest Region
POSITION SUMMARY
In this position, you will be responsible for identifying new business opportunities, maintaining strong client relationships, and driving sales growth across the Northwest region, including Minnesota, Wisconsin, North Dakota, South Dakota, Nebraska, Kansas, Iowa, Missouri, Wyoming, Montana, and Idaho.
RESPONSIBILITIES
Develop and execute sales strategies to achieve and exceed revenue goals
Build and maintain relationships with O&P clients, distributors, and partners
Deliver product demonstrations and technical presentations
Manage the full sales cycle from lead generation to closing
Collaborate with internal teams to ensure a seamless customer experience
Analyze market trends and provide insights to support product development
Prepare regular reports on sales progress and customer engagement
Represent the company at trade shows and industry events
Travel up to 70%
QUALIFICATIONS
5–7 years of B2B sales experience
Based in the Midwest region
Proven record of achieving or surpassing sales targets
Strong communication, negotiation, and presentation abilities
Capable of managing multiple accounts and priorities
Self-motivated with the 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ment
Proficient in Microsoft Office, Google Docs, and Slack
Willingness to travel throughout the Midwest
P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S
Background in selling O&P technology solutions
5–7 years of experience selling into the O&P profession
Experience with CRM systems and sales tracking tools
Bachelor’s degree in Business, Marketing, or related fields
LOCATION Midwest, U.S. (Remote)
EMPLOYMENT TYPE Full-Time (At-will Employment)
SALARY USD60,000-90,000 + incentive program
ADDITIONAL BENEFITS
Comprehensive benefits package
Stock options available
